Introduction
Simplex cable uses single tight buffer fiber as optical communication medium, tight buffer fiber wrapped with a layer of aramid yarns as strength member and the cable is completed with TPU jacket.
Product Introduction
The ultra bending insensitive single-mode optical fiber BendCom® G.657.B3 has outstanding bending performance, especially at 5 mm bending radius. The refractive index profile distribution is optimized so that the fiber can be fully compatible with G.657.A2 fiber, making it the best product for fiber-to-the-home (FTTH).

Optical fiber type and properties
G657B3 Characteristic of Optical Fiber
ITEM | Unit | Specification | |
G. 657B3 | |||
Mode field diameter | 1310nm | mm | 9.2 ± 0.4 |
1550nm | mm | 10.4 ± 0.5 | |
Cladding diameter | mm | 125.0 ± 0.7 | |
Cladding non-circularity | % | ≤1.0 | |
Core concentricity error | mm | ≤0.5 | |
Coating diameter | mm | 242 ± 7 | |
Coating/cladding concentricity error | mm | ≤12 | |
Cable cut-off wavelength | nm | ≤1260 | |
Attenuation Coefficient | 1310nm | dB/km | ≤0.35 |
1383 nm | dB/km | ≤0.33 | |
1550nm | dB/km | ≤0.21 | |
1625 nm | dB/km | ≤0.23 | |
Proof stress level | kpsi | ≥100 |
Other parameters meet standard ITU-T G.657.B3

PACKING:
1 Nominal shipping length of the cable will be 1~3 km. Other length is also available if required by buyer.
2 Each length of the cable will be wound on a separate strong wooden.
3 Both ends of the cable will be sealed with a suitable heat shrinkable cap to prevent the entry of moisture during transportation and storage.
4 The cable end will be securely fastened to the drum to prevent the cable from coming loose during transit or becoming loose during placing operations.
5 Circumference battens will be secured between the outer edges of the flange to protect the cable against damage during shipment and storage.
6 For testing purposes, the inner end of the cable will be recessed into a slot in the drum flange . A minimum length of one meter of cable at the inner end will be accessible.
7 The cable will be shipped on drums designed to prevent damage to the cable during shipment and installation
8 The minimum barrel diameter of the drum will be 30 times to the overall cable diameter.
